| Study | Type of data | Exposure measurement | Outcome assessment | Adjustment |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Anderson, 2020 | case control | Information on exposure to TCAs and other potential risk factors during pregnancy were collected by standardized telephone interviews with mothers of case and control infants, conducted 6 weeks to 24 months after the estimated date of delivery (EDD). | Case infants were ascertained through population-based birth-defects surveillance systems in 10 U.S. states. Controls were selected randomly from the same geographic areas. Clinical data were abstracted from medical records and classified by clinician geneticists and other clinicians. | No adjustment for this group of exposure. |
| Kjaersgaard (Controls unexposed, NOS), 2013 | population based cohort retrospective | Information on all redeemed prescriptions was obtained from the Denmark Registry of Medicinal Product Statistics. | Clinically recognized abortions were identified in the Danish National Hospital Registry, that contains data on in- and outpatient contacts in Denmark coded according to a Danish version of the 10th revision of the International Classification of Diseases (ICD-10). | No adjustment for this group of exposure. |
| Kjaersgaard (Controls unexposed, sick), 2013 | population based cohort retrospective | Information on all redeemed prescriptions was obtained from the Denmark Registry of Medicinal Product Statistics. | Clinically recognized abortions were identified in the Danish National Hospital Registry, that contains data on in- and outpatient contacts in Denmark coded according to a Danish version of the 10th revision of the International Classification of Diseases (ICD-10). | No adjustment for this group of exposure. |
| Kolding (Controls unexposed, disease free), 2021 | population based cohort retrospective | Exposure to antidepressants was measured using redeemed prescriptions through linkage to the Danish Health Services Prescription Database. | Data on prenatally diagnosed cardiac malformations came from the Danish Fetal Medicine Database and data on cardiac malformations diagnosed up to 1 year postnatally came from the Danish National Patient Registry. | Variables included in the analysis with propensity score fine stratification: ethnicity, civil status, parity, age, BMI, smoking, exposure to teratogens, antihypertensives, antidiabetics, use of other psychotropic drugs, depression diagnosis, diabetes diagnosis. |
| Kolding (Controls unexposed, sick), 2021 | population based cohort retrospective | Exposure to antidepressants was measured using redeemed prescriptions through linkage to the Danish Health Services Prescription Database. | Data on prenatally diagnosed cardiac malformations came from the Danish Fetal Medicine Database and data on cardiac malformations diagnosed up to 1 year postnatally came from the Danish National Patient Registry. | Adjusted for smoking and age at conception. |
